What Does It Mean?
The eagle (cheel, garuda) is Vishnu's vehicle — the highest-flying bird represents supreme vision, divine perspective, and protection from all enemies
Seeing an eagle soaring high in a dream signals that you are being lifted to a higher perspective where current problems appear small and manageable
An eagle diving for prey signals a decisive, swift action that will capture an important opportunity — be decisive and fast when the moment arrives
Being protected by an eagle or riding one in a dream is a supreme omen of Vishnu's direct protection and guidance
